Lionel Messi

Some say Lionel Messi will never be able to claim a place among the sport's greats such as Alfredo Di Stefano, Pele, Johan Cruyff and Diego Maradona, unless he wins the World Cup. But many others believe, at the age of 26 -- he turns 27 during the tournament on June 24 -- the four-time world player-of-the-year already has.
A lot will depend on how well he copes with the pressure and shrugs off an out-of-character, indifferent spell towards the end of the Spanish season.
An attack-minded Argentina generally play with Messi alongside close friend Aguero in attack and Barca teammate Javier Mascherano controlling play in the middle.
He spent a couple of months on the sidelines before returning in January and this could work in Argentina's favour as he may arrive fresher than other players.
